Shell Pernis Group I Base Oil Plant Officially Closed

Shell has confirmed to OEM/Lube News that it has officially closed the API Group I base oil plant at its refinery in Pernis, Netherlands, in the first quarter this year. Pernis is a sub municipality of Rotterdam.

"I can confirm that the asset is now closed: this happened during Q1 2016. I can also confirm we continue to serve our customer as per usual and required after this change. Shell has a robust security of supply in its global network.", Shell spokesperson Mary Walsh told OEM/Lube News.

The Pernis plant, which had 370,000 metric tons per year (7,100 barrels per day) of Group I capacity, is over 60 years old and no longer efficient enough to compete, and that the global outlook for base oils is too weak to warrant the investment required to upgrade it, according to the company.

On April 22, 2014, Shell said it planned the closure of the two trains in two phases, with one train closing at the end of 2015 and the second likely to close in early 2016.

Shell sold its only other European base oils unit at the UK 296,000 bpd Stanlow refinery to Essar in 2011. Essar has since closed that production, citing the reduced refinery economics for base oils.

Shell also has a Group I plant in Pulau Bukom, Singapore, with 7,400 bpd Group I capacity and a smaller Group I plant in Buenos Aires, Argentina, with 1,500 bpd capacity.
